BMW 2 Series Gran Coupe launched

BMW has launched the new 2 Series Gran Coupe in the Indian market. Priced at Rs 39.30 lakhs (ex showroom) the new 2 Series Gran Coupe sits below the 3 series and is the most affordable model in BMW’s line-up.

Buyers can get theirs in two versions M Sport and Sport line. It measures in at 4,526mm in length, 1,800mm in width, and 1,420mm in height. It has a wheelbase of 2,670mm and rides on 225/45 section tyres with double spoke bi-colouR17 alloy wheels on the Sport line and 225/40 section tyres with double spoke bi-colour R18 alloy wheels in the M Sport

The sedan overall has a distinct design with a coupe like roofline and low centre of gravity. The front end looks stunning with the low slung bonnet and the distinctly styled LED headlights, the kidney grille at the front is not too large and looks perfectly shaped for its size. The bumper lower down gets gloss black c-shaped elements near the daytime ruing lights and a black honeycomb air dam as well.

 The side profile has an interesting profile with the slopping roofline blending well in the four door coupe. The frameless doors are sure to grab your attention and so are the alloy wheels as well.  

The rear however with its slim fitting LED taillights and high boot lid ends up looking a little stubby; however the several cuts and creases in the design break the mass well, while the dual exhausts complete the look.

The interior of the 2 Series Gran Coupe comes finished in typical BMW style with high quality materials and black and beige dual tone colours; however the main highlight is at the dashboard with the 10.25 inch touchscreen which is angled towards the driver for easier access while on the road. It also gets a digital instrument cluster that has been designed well in an age of digital clusters.

Space on the inside is pretty decent with good headroom and legroom in the cabin, while at the rear the overall space is decent but taller passengers will find headroom a little tight thanks to the slopping roofline. Boot space stands at 430 litres and can be further extended to with the 60:40 split seat option.

Talking about features, the 2 series Gran Coupe comes pretty loaded with kit like LED daytime running lights, LED taillights, BMW  logo projection from wing mirrors, backlit door handles,  automatic headlights and wipers, 2 zone climate control, 6 colour ambient lighting and electric adjustment for front driver and passenger seats with memory function.

The 10.25 inch infotainment system with Bluetooth connectivity with handsfree audio streaming and USB connectivity. There’s also wireless Android Auto, BMW virtual assistant activated by “HEY BMW” voice command, BMW gesture control, navigation with 3D maps, latest I-drive control with hand writing recognition and direct access buttons. A total 6 speakers sound system is on offer in the Sport line trim and 10 speakers hi-fi loudspeaker system in the M Sport variant is on offer.

Under the hood the 2 Series Gran Coupe comes powered by just one engine option which is a 2.0 litre diesel motor. It churns out 190hp and 400Nm of torque and comes mated to an 8-speed automatic transmission with paddle shifters.

BMW has also packed in 6 airbags, dynamic stability control, cornering braking control, electronic vehicle immobilizer, BMW intelligent management system, ABS with braking control, dynamic traction control, electronic differential lock, ISOFIX child seat mounting, tyre pressure monitoring system and crash sensors as part of the safety kit in the 2 series Gran Coupe.

In terms of paint schemes, BMW is offering 7 paint scheme options which are

  1. Alpine white

  2. Black Sapphire

  3. Melbourne Red

  4. Seaside Blue ( Sport line only)

  5. Storm Grey

  6. Misano Blue ( M Sport only)

  7. Snapper Rocks ( M Sport only)

The BMW 2 Series Gran Coupe at the moment has no real competition with the only rival present is the Audi Q2 (which is an SUV of course), while the real rival the Mercedes A Class will arrive around the festive season.
